Demand side Management of Agriculture pumping sector through Star rated Energy Efficient Pump sets

The Power sector in India provides major opportunities for reducing energy consumption by creating awareness on existing Energy inefficiencies of practical, operational and financial nature. Substitution of more inductive Energy inefficient pump sets in agriculture has been identified as one of the key strategy initiatives, which is up to date, has been limited to a few pilot projects. The objective is to replace Energy inefficient pumpsets with the (Bureau of energy efficiency) BEE 5 star rated Energy efficient pumpsets. This paper gives detailed energy audit of the total pump sets existing in the study area. The study includes measuring the present operating efficiency of 973 agricultural pump sets which were identified in the thirty one feeders of Sampathnagaram section, East Godavari District, AP and The practical efficiency analysis has been demonstrated by replacing the existing pump sets with the BEE 5 star rated energy efficient pumpsets.The efficiency analysis reveals that the energy consumption drastically reduced, which leads to energy saving on the feeders at consumer end. Also a future insight into the Demand side management and promoting the BEE energy efficient Pump sets on rural area. This involvement can lead to lower energy supply on the feeder, and for this reason lower subsidized energy sale by utilities and the subsidy to be paid by the State Government will be reduced.
